SIDE CHANNEL COVERINGS

Investigations In City Streets

Investigations are being made by the City Council to see if sections of Gloucester street and Victoria street are suitable for the covering of side channels. The work committee has provision in the estimates for £2OOO to provide for some covering of dished side channels or their replacement by flat channels. In the central area many dished channels require replacement or extensive repairs, and the council's policy is to give preference to that area before the suburban shopping areas. One of the reasons is that a systematic replacement will help effective conversion of central cleansing from a manual to a mechanical system. In Hereford street, between Manchester street and Oxford terrace, the southern side channel requires general replacement, although the northern does not. It seems that £2OOO would not do much more than half the southern channel. In Gloucester street, between Manchester street and the terrace, much of the side channel is already covered and the rest can be partiallv covered, partially replaced by flat channel and partially replaced by a pipe under a flat channel. The position in Victoria street is complicated by future widening. On the west side between Healey avenue and Dorset street defective channels have been replaced and the area generally improved, and it is probable that the work will continue down to Salisbury street.
